Brockport, NY - The Brockport Baseball team rode a balanced performance to a 9-1 home opener win against SUNY Poly on Friday, March 29
th. The Golden Eagles improved to 9-3 on the season following the win, increasing their winning streak to 6 games.
Â
Brockport would strike first in the opening frame, with
Zach Eldred's sacrifice fly scoring Josh Index to give the Golden Eagles a 1-0 lead.
Â
In the bottom of the third,
Zach Eldred would drive home another run for his second RBI of the day, quickly followed by a
Cole Traudt RBI groundout to put Brockport ahead 3-0.
Â
The Wildcats would chip into the lead in the 4
th, scoring their first and only run thanks to a Ryan Pelton RBI groundout to make the score 3-1 Brockport.
Â
In the top of the 7
th inning,
Justin DelVecchio would make quick work of the opposition, punching out 3 Wildcats on 9 pitches for an immaculate inning. DelVecchio would go two hitless innings with 5 strikeouts. Â Â Â
Â
The Golden Eagles would take control in the 8
th inning, taking advantage of two Wildcat errors to score 6 runs in the inning, highlighted by
TJ Strevell's RBI triple and
Josh Indek's RBI single.
Â
Troy Leibert would lock up the win for Brockport, tossing two scoreless innings with two strikeouts to give Brockport the 9-1 victory. Â Â
Â
Ryan Peters (W, 2-1) was excellent throughout, providing 5 innings of 1 hit baseball with 5 strikeouts in a winning effort.
Â
Aaron Kifer (L, 3-1) was strong in defeat for SUNY Poly, allowing just 3 runs across 6 innings of work.
Â
Josh Indek would finish the contest with 3 hits, 2 runs, and a stolen bag for the Green and Gold.
Â
Frank Vanzillotta (2/4, 1BB) and
Logan Wing (1/2, 2BB) both reached base safely 3 times for Brockport.
Â
Brian Tietjen (2/3) and
TJ Strevell (2/4, 1RBI) would contribute two hits each in the win.
